Introduction

Fish oil though not a vitamin has come to be commonly known as fish oil vitamins. Its a nutritional supplement. Omega-3 fatty acids  found in fish oil vitamins are essential fatty acids that must be supplied in the diet. They are part of the fat in food that is consumed from a balanced diet.

Throughout life, the omega-3 fatty acids are important to support health and likely to reduce risk of chronic disease. The biological and physiological effects of dietary lipids on human health remain a primary focus of nutrition research as recommendations for daily intake are continually updated in response to new information obtained through epidemiological, clinical, and animal investigations

Fish oil vitamins as essential it is, they are not being being used as prevelantly as they are supposed to be. It is one of the most essential dietary element. It can be supplemented directly by consuming fish containing fish oil or other processed supplementations. Fish oil vitamins consists of omega 3 fatty acids which again can be broken into finer components such as DHA (Docosahexaeonic acid) and EPA (Episapentaeonic acid).

Fish Oil Health Benefits

Omega 3 fatty acid helps in producing neurotransmitter, reducing inflammation caused by degenerative diseases such as heart disease, diabetics, alzheimers, arthrities etc. And it helps in developing brain cells, smooth movement s of joints, better digestions and so on.

Fish oil can be obtained from two parts of the fish: the flesh and the liver. The fish oil extracted from the flesh has a high concentration of EPA and DHA, the two most esseential omega-3 fatty acids. The fish oil from the liver also has this, but it also has a high content of Vitamins A and D.

Due to the highly unsaturated nature of fish oil it quicky gets oxidized. And causes the fish oil to be rancid. Taking the rancid fish oil will causes various ill effects starting with fishy after taste, body odor etc. However scientist have discoverd a way to overcome this problem and preserve it. Adding vitamin E such as tocopherol will prevent the fish oil from geting rancid as well as well as prevent the degeneration of the properties of omega 3 fatty acids.

While choosing the best fish oil vitamins few things must be kept in mind.

1. One must be careful not to choose products with refortified additives. For eg. there have been instance where companies have added synthetic vitamins such a vitamin A and D. This products should be avoided and preference shoud be given to products with high content of EPA & DHA.

2. Buy product from big brand because they have high y systematic process and reduces the risk of  toxin in the product. However, in cheap or non recognizable brands chances of contamination and toxin are highly probable
